Chandigarh, Feb. 17 -- The Punjab and Haryana high court on Monday dismissed a plea by suspended DIG Harcharan Singh Bhullar, 59, seeking bail in the corruption case registered by the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) on October 16 last year.

On January 2, the trial court in Chandigarh had rejected his bail plea, observing that "the case constitutes a class apart being an alarming economic offence". Subsequently, Bhullar had approached the high court for bail on January 9. After hearing arguments from both sides, the plea was dismissed by the bench of justice Sumeet Goel on Monday. Detailed order is awaited.
